Description
This research project aims to develop a combined osteochondral scaffold by integrating GreenBone's bone scaffold with Stemmatters' hydrogel technology. This innovative solution is designed to enhance bone and cartilage regeneration, addressing both traumatic injuries and degenerative conditions such as osteoarthritis and osteoarthrosis. CBQF-UCP will focus on creating a reliable procedure for combining these two distinct products. This involves optimizing the physical and chemical conditions necessary for the seamless integration
of the bone scaffold and the hydrogel. UCP will also perform rigorous mechanical testing to evaluate the stability and durability of the combined scaffold, ensuring it can withstand physiological loads and maintain structural integrity.
